One million refugees left Ukraine since Russia’s invasion – UN

ONE million people have fled Ukraine in the seven days since Russia invaded the country, the United Nations’ refugee agency said yesterday.

“In just seven days we have witnessed the exodus of one million refugees from Ukraine to neighbouring countries,” Filippo Grandi, the UN high commissioner for refugees (UNHCR), said in a statement on Twitter.
